Postmortem Timeline — Paybranch retry storm

09:12 — Gateway timeouts kicked off client retries, and since Paybranch wasn't enforcing idempotency keys yet, a handful of customers got double-charged. 09:30 — Retries paused. 10:05 — Hotfix shipped requiring an idempotency key on every charge call; duplicates refunded by noon. Lesson for new folks: keys aren't optional. The fix shipped under the build token below.

trace token, tawep-fahif: htk3_b58

**Leadership Review Briefing — Expansion into the Maravelle Region**

For the finance team: this briefing outlines the proposed entry into the Maravelle region for the Orvana product line. Capital requirements, staged hiring costs, and regulatory filing fees have been modelled conservatively across three scenarios. Break-even is projected within eight quarters under the base case. The confidential strategic summary appears below.

internal memo for fahif-bawip: Headcount on the Ralael team goes from 48 to 96 by the end of December. Gross margin on Ralael came in at 14 percent against a plan of 3 percent.

Welcome to Cartwheel, our rules engine for shipping fees. Rules live in YAML, evaluate top-down, first match wins — resist the urge to add priority fields, we tried, it was bad. Rule history sits in an encrypted archive; when you first mount it, it'll ask for the team recovery passphrase, which is right here.

vault phrase of tajop-haduf = holath-brivan-wenax

Ticket: Baseline drift in Lintmarsh static analysis — bring to eng sync

So the Lintmarsh baseline file has drifted again: CI regenerates it on main but two long-lived branches carry their own copies, and we're now suppressing about forty findings nobody reviewed. Proposal: make the baseline read-only in CI and require a manual regen PR. Want to discuss at the sync. For context, the analyzer currently runs with the following configuration.

config for fahap-badup:
[ralath]
port = 3000
region = lower-2
host = ralath.tolvaqsys.corp
timeout_ms = 3000
retries = 4